Causa Natura Media is a non-profit media, founded in 2020, that has been innovative in covering social and environmental issues through data and investigative journalism in the region. Its agenda covers regional and local events, with a view to reaching a Hispanic audience in the United States and Latin America. Causa Natura Media makes analysis and investigations, as well as data journalism, opinions, interviews available to its audience, thereby contributing to the monitoring of matters of public interest. Currently, Causa Natura Media's long-term investigations are taken up by more than a dozen Mexican media and it is expected that in the coming years in other countries in the region. Causa Natura Media has been one of the media that has made marine issues the most visible in Mexico in recent years, with a series of reports that have used novel techniques such as satellite data and map visualization. CNM has provided support and training to the Sea Journalism Network, an initiative of Causa Natura Media, which the Earth Journalism Network supported for its birth in 2022 and which today brings together more than 40 journalists interested in marine issues. The medium is one of the brands of Causa Natura together with Causa Natura Center, a relevant think tank in environmental policies, both under the general direction of Eduardo Rolón. Causa Natura Media survives thanks to financing from international donors, while it works on the implementation of a subscription model with its readers.
